Previous CompTIA A+ Certification

 Based on 2003 objectives


 Two exams:
A+ Core Hardware (exam 220-301)
A+ OS Technologies (exam 220-302)
 Certification is for life
 Current IT Essentials PC v3.1
course aligned to these
objectives

New CCNA 307 © 2007 Cisco Systems, Inc. All rights reserved. Cisco Public 10
Previous CompTIA A+ Certification
Exams

 CompTIA will retire these exams on June 30, 2007


 Networking Academy program students will have
access to certification exam discount coupons
upon graduation from an IT Essentials PC class
 They must complete both exams successfully by
June 30, 2007 in order to be A+ certified under the
previous exams
 After that date, they will need to complete the 2006
certification exams path

A+ Certification Exam Update
 New, 2006 Objectives exam announced in June 2006
 Different certification paths aimed at different job
markets
 New topics on laptops, security, safety and
communication and professionalism
 Two exams must still be passed to obtain certification:
1. A+ Essentials (220-601)
2. PLUS any of the three job-skills exams:
– 220-602 - IT Technician (Field Service Technician)
– 220-603 - Remote Support (Help Desk Technician)
– 220-604 - Depot Technician (Bench Technician)

IT Essentials: PC Hardware and Software
Course Objectives
 Define Information Technology (IT) and detail the components of the personal computer
 Protect the student against accident and injury, equipment from damage, and the environment
from contamination
 Perform a step by step assembly of a desktop computer tower
 Explain the purpose of preventive maintenance and identify the elements of the troubleshooting
process
 Explain, install, navigate, perform preventive maintenance on, and begin troubleshooting an
Operating System, laptop and printer/scanner
 Describe, install, perform preventive maintenance on, and begin troubleshooting a network
 Describe, install, perform preventive maintenance on, and begin troubleshooting security
 Describe and apply good communication skills and professional behavior while working with
customers
 Perform advanced installation, select components based on customer need, perform preventive
maintenance on, and perform advanced troubleshooting of a desktop computer tower
 Upgrade, select components based on customer need, perform preventive maintenance on, and
perform advanced troubleshooting of an Operating System
 Remove and replace select components of, perform preventive maintenance on, and describe
advanced troubleshooting of a laptop and printer/scanner
 Upgrade, select components based on customer need, perform preventive maintenance on, and
perform advanced troubleshooting on a network
 Upgrade, select components based on customer need, perform preventive maintenance on, and
perform advanced troubleshooting of security

New CCNA 307 © 2007 Cisco Systems, Inc. All rights reserved. Cisco Public 16
IT Essentials: PC Hardware and Software
Course Outline
Ch PC Hardware and Software
1 Fundamentals: Introduction to the Personal Computer
2 Fundamentals: Safe Lab Procedure and Tool Use
3 Fundamentals: Computer Assembly Step by Step
4 Fundamentals: Basics of Preventive Maintenance and Troubleshooting
5 Fundamentals: Operating Systems
6 Fundamentals: Laptops & Portable Devices
7 Fundamentals: Printers and Scanners
8 Fundamentals: Networks
9 Fundamentals: Security
10 Fundamentals: Communication Skills
11 Advanced: Personal Computers
12 Advanced: Operating Systems
13 Advanced: Laptops and Portable Devices
14 Advanced: Printers and Scanners
15 Advanced: Networks
16 Advanced: Security

Equipment Requirements
New/Changes

 Hardware:
Two 128 MB memory modules (minimum) or two 256 MB
memory modules (recommended)
 Software:
Microsoft Windows XP Professional (Media CD)
 Additional Items/Resources:
One Linksys wireless router/switch or equivalent per two Lab
PCs, Linksys model WRT 300N preferred
One Wireless PCI network adapter (compatible with the above
wireless router/switch) for each Lab PC

New CCNA 307 © 2007 Cisco Systems, Inc. All rights reserved. Cisco Public 20
Typical Lab Layout

 Lab size of 12-15 students for hands-on lab activities


–Recommended: a ratio of 1 Lab PC per student

 Some lab activities require the student Lab PCs to be


connected to a local network
 2 instructor workstations
–1 connected to Internet to search for and download files
–Other instructor workstation used for hands-on lab
demonstrations
